What is Saas?
Think of SaaS (Software as a Service) like switching from owning a car to using a high-end rideshare service. Instead of buying a car, parking it in your own garage, and having to change the oil and fix the engine yourself, you simply use an app to access a vehicle that is maintained and fueled by someone else.
In the tech world, instead of Southern owning the software and keeping it on physical servers in a building on campus (which requires our staff to manually install updates and fix hardware), we subscribe to it over the internet. The company (Ellucian) handles all the heavy lifting, like security updates, backups, and improvements in the cloud. For you, it means the system is more reliable, works from any web browser, and always stays up to date without us having to take the system offline for a weekend to fix the engine.

Ellucian Experience is designed to solve familiar problems we all face: too many systems, too many logins, and too many disconnected places to find basic information.
Instead of asking students, faculty, and staff to jump between separate platforms for grades, financial aid, schedules, announcements, email, and other campus resources, Experience brings those tools together in a single dashboard. The goal is not to replace every system behind the scenes, but to make the front door to those systems much easier to use.
The dashboard is organized around cards, which function a lot like widgets. A student might see cards for class schedules, account balances, grades, campus announcements, email, or dining information. A faculty member might see teaching schedules, class rosters, advisee information, or other tools tied to their daily work. Staff dashboards can be tailored around the systems and updates most relevant to their roles.
One of the biggest benefits is single sign-on. After logging in once, users can move between connected services without repeatedly entering credentials. This removes a lot of friction from the day-to-day campus experience.
Ellucian Experience gives the university a clean digital entry point. It takes information and services scattered across multiple systems and organizes them in one place, with a layout that works across desktop and mobile. For students, especially, that means less time searching for the right link and more direct access to the information they actually need.
If Ellucian Experience serves as the front door to the digital campus, Ellucian Journey is more focused on the path after students arrive.
At its core, Journey is designed to connect academic planning with career outcomes. That matters because students are increasingly asking a very practical question: how does this course, certificate, or degree translate into a job?
Rather than starting with a traditional course catalog, Journey begins with career goals. A student, adult learner, or continuing education participant can explore potential career paths and see the skills, credentials, and labor market demand associated with those roles. For example, someone interested in data analytics, healthcare administration, cybersecurity, or project management could use the platform to better understand what employers are looking for and which skills are commonly tied to those opportunities.
From there, Journey can help map those career goals back to the institution’s academic offerings. Instead of leaving students to sort through dozens of courses, certificates, or micro-credentials on their own, the platform can recommend a more structured path based on the student’s goals, prior experience, and available programs.
The other key piece is progress tracking. Rather than showing academic progress only through credits and grades, Journey is built around skills and competencies. A student can see not just that they completed a course, but what capabilities they are building along the way. That creates a clearer connection between academic work and career readiness.
Journey helps make education feel less abstract. It gives students a better answer to the question, “Why am I taking this class?” by showing how individual courses and credentials can contribute to a broader career path.
Scholarship Universe is designed to make the scholarship search process more manageable for students.
Looking for scholarships can be frustrating and time-consuming. Students may spend hours searching online, sorting through opportunities that do not apply to them, or trying to determine which sites are legitimate. Scholarship Universe brings that process into a single, secure campus platform.
The experience starts with a student profile. After logging in, students answer questions about their academic background, major, GPA, interests, activities, career goals, and other relevant criteria. That information is then used to match them with scholarship opportunities that may be a good fit.
Those matches can include both internal scholarships offered by the university, colleges, departments, or specific programs, as well as external scholarships from vetted outside organizations. Instead of asking students to search broadly and guess which opportunities they qualify for, the platform narrows the list to scholarships that are more likely to be relevant.
Students can also manage the process from one dashboard. They can review scholarship matches, track deadlines, save opportunities they want to revisit, upload required materials, and request recommendation letters when needed. That gives students a clearer view of what is available and what steps they still need to complete.
External scholarships listed in the platform are reviewed before they are presented to students, which helps reduce the risk of scams, hidden fees, or questionable scholarship sites. Scholarship Universe means less time searching through unreliable information and more time applying for funding opportunities that actually make sense for them.
